## Deployment

FeatherCast Validator runs as a stateless worker pulling feed URLs from the Mossgate queue. Deploys go out via the Tindry pipeline; nothing is provisioned by hand. Reviewers should confirm that any change to parsing limits is reflected in both the schema tests and the environment manifest. For reference, the current production configuration is as follows.

deployment values, fahap-hahaf:
[casdor]
port = 9200
region = south-2
host = casdor.qirvanworks.corp
timeout_ms = 3000
retries = 4

Plugin authors targeting the Frostvault archival API have reported intermittent connection failures when archiving cold storage buckets larger than 50 GB. The failures occur because the archival worker re-resolves the catalog host mid-transfer, and stale entries cause the handshake to time out. Until the resolver fix ships in 3.4, plugins should bypass discovery and connect to the bucket catalog directly, with retries capped at three. For direct access during archival runs, use the connection string below.

warehouse DSN: mssql://rusdor_svc:0FSWCn9@db-951a.paliqforge.local:5432/ulawyn

Subject: Quillbus broker upgrade — review needed

Team,

Bumping Quillbus from 3.2 to 4.0 on the Lanterfell cluster tonight. Breaking change: ack timeouts now default to 30s, so consumers in the Pellweave service need the override flag. PR is up; please check the migration shim in consumer_init before approving. Rollback is a config flip, no data loss expected. The token for this build is appended below.

trace token, hahof-bafop: htk3_b54

**Onboarding — Restockr planner plugins.** External authors: register your plugin against the Restockr staging planner, not production. Route plans are signed; your plugin must pass the Halvane signature check before scheduling restocks. To unlock the shared staging keystore on first run, you'll be prompted once. Use the passphrase that follows.

unlock words, hahip-baduf: holwyn-istath-julvan